ostwald's theory of indicators

 

Definitions from WordNet

Noun ostwald's theory of indicators has 1 sense
  1. theory of indicators, Ostwald's theory of indicators - (chemistry) the theory that all indicators are either weak acids or weak bases in which the color of the ionized form is different from the color before dissociation
    --1 is a kind of scientific theory

Ostwald's Theory of Indicators

Ostwald's Theory of Indicators is a concept in chemistry that explains the behavior of acid-base indicators.

Definitions

  • Noun: A theory proposed by Wilhelm Ostwald, stating that acid-base indicators function by changing their color based on the ratios of acid and base species present in a solution.
